Biography

Yangyang Li is a PhD candidate at the Department of Astronomy at the University of Florida in Gainesville, Florida, USA, and is expected to receive his degree in 2024. He completed his undergraduate degree in Physics at the University of Science and Technology of China in 2014. His primary areas of interest are stellar physics, computational astrophysics, and machine learning. He has developed and released multiple open source codes for stellar spectroscopy research, contributing significantly to the field, particularly in automating spectroscopy analysis and incorporating advanced deep learning techniques. Additionally, he actively participates in APOGEE, GALAH, and RPA spectrograph surveys
